Currently, when you start Karaf (or connect remotely to a karaf
instance), you get a shell looking like:
karaf@root>
The "root" is the karaf instance name and could be changed using the
karaf.name property defined in etc/system.properties file.
The "karaf" part is hard coded in Karaf and not yet linked to users
defined (especially when you enable some JAAS support using a database
or LDAP backend :)).
We can consider this "karaf" as a shell name, and we could consider this
as linked to the branding.
Karaf branding is looking for a
org/apache/karaf/branding/branding.properties file containing a welcome
property.
This property is used by the Karaf branding support (at bootstrap) to
display the welcome message.
I propose to extend this branding.properties file by adding another
shell.name property defining the shell name.
If the property is not found or null, we fall back to "karaf" as it is
currently.
